I am an Australian photographer, visual storyteller and creative practitioner whose artistic journey spans more than two decades. Beginning with traditional black and white film photography and darkroom printing during high school, my visual arts practice has continually evolved alongside developments in photography and digital imaging while remaining grounded in the belief that photography is both an art form and a means of preserving culture, history and human connection.

Carbonix — BVLOS & VTOL Operations: Trained by Carbonix’s Chief Remote Pilot, I worked as part of a BVLOS crew deploying Australian-made, 3.6m wingspan VTOL fixed-wing drones for extended EVLOS and BVLOS missions, capturing high-resolution LiDAR and photogrammetry across remote locations Australia-wide.
